The solution
By mapping a smaller set of controls across multiple programs, your organization can unify and streamline its operations, saving weeks of duplicative work. Working with related requirements and leveraging Jumpstart in Hyperproof allows you to consolidate into a smaller, more manageable set of controls.
Hyperproof’s crosswalks cover 99% of the requirements in its program library, ensuring that most programs have at least some overlap. With over 150 frameworks mapped to nearly 2,500 topics, Hyperproof’s crosswalk dataset is the industry's largest and most granular mapping. This dataset is curated by our internal experts, assisted by high-reasoning LLMs (Gemini Pro, ChatGPT Pro, Claude Pro). Although the dataset is unique to Hyperproof, it is constructed using the Secure Controls Framework methodology.
Example scenario
Your organization already has an ISO 27001 program; now you want to set up a SOC 2 program. Hyperproof examines the requirements in both programs and maps the requirements from your ISO 27001 program to your SOC 2 program. Hyperproof calls these mapped requirements related requirements. Related requirements can be viewed in the details pane of any requirement in your Hyperproof instance. Optionally, members of your programs can add and remove related requirements, including your custom programs.
To map controls to your new SOC 2 program, you can leverage the jumpstart feature to immediately import your controls from your ISO 27001 program, using the related requirements as the connecting tissue.
